description
Nestled in the highly sought-after and peaceful village of Fritchley is this attractive four-bedroom detached family home occupying a generous corner plot and enjoys delightful countryside views, beautifully maintained gardens and has the added benefit of a detached garage. Offered to the market with no upward chain, this is a rare opportunity to acquire a well-presented home in an idyllic semi-rural setting. The property offers spacious and versatile accommodation throughout and in brief comprises, a garden room, dining hallway, a fitted kitchen, lounge, study/bedroom four with an upper level, three bedrooms, a family bathroom and a ground floor shower room.
Externally, there is a stunning garden wrapping around the property which has been lovingly maintained having a variety of mature flowers bushes and shrubs and has open aspect countryside views. The property is tucked away on a corner plot and has a driveway with a detached garage to the front.
